Mozilla Foundation Partnership Training and Badge Program

The Mozilla Foundation Engagement Team offers free Partnership Training to Webmaker community members. Participants who receive the training will develop skills in all parts of the partnership development process from identifying and cultivating leads all the way through "closing" the partnership.

Members who complete the training program and successfully close a partnership under the guidance of a staff person will receive the Partnerships Badge. Mozilla Foundation staff team up with those who've earned the Partnership badge to help secure local resources for their projects.

About the Training

The training is delivered via a real time, virtual conversation (or in person, if possible) by a member of the Mozilla Foundation staff.

The training covers:

  • Current projects across Mozilla
  • How Mozilla is structured and funded
  • The Mozilla Manifesto and 4 Pillars
  • Levels of partnership
  • The Five Stages of Development
    • Leads
    • Conversations
    • Shaping
    • Work
    • Transition
  • Our systems

Completion of the Training

After the training, members enter into a mentorship period with a staff member, and work to close a partnership. After successfully closing a partnership, community members are awarded the Partnerships Badge.

Once awarded the Badge, trained community members have access to:

  • materials (such as one-pagers)
  • tools (such as proposal tracking software)
  • legal services necessary for partnership building
  • strategic support
  • pitch support
  • potentially fiscal sponsorship
